== Old English == === Etymology === From Proto-West Germanic *gabaddjō. Cognate with Old Frisian bedda and Old Saxon gibeddio. Equivalent to ġe- +‎ bedd +‎ -a. === Pronunciation === IPA(key): /jeˈbed.dɑ/ === Noun === ġebedda m someone who lies in bed with someone else: bedfellow husband or wife late 10th century, Ælfric, Lives of Saints consort ==== Declension ==== Weak: ==== Coordinate terms ==== ġebedde === References === Joseph Bosworth; T.
